St. Louis Cardinals @ Chicago Cubs

1953-05-26 Β· Day game Β· Wrigley Field Β· 2:43

St. Louis Cardinals defeated Chicago Cubs 6–3. St. Louis Cardinals put up 3 in the 2nd. Harvey Haddix earned the win. Red Schoendienst went 3-for-3 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.
